DETECTING OVARIAN CANCER
Provided herein is technology for ovarian cancer screening and particularly, but not exclusively, to methods, compositions, and related uses for detecting the presence of ovarian cancer and sub-types of ovarian cancer (e.g., clear cell ovarian cancer, endometrioid ovarian cancer, mucinous ovarian cancer, serous ovarian cancer).

13 . A method comprising:
treating DNA from a sample from a subject having or suspected of having cancer with a reagent that modifies DNA in a methylation-specific manner;
amplifying the treated DNA using a set of primers specific for GYPC and/or ZSCAN12; and
determining a methylation level of at least one differentially methylated region (DMR) in each of GYPC and/or ZSCAN12 using polymerase chain reaction (PCR), nucleic acid sequencing, mass spectrometry, restriction enzyme analysis, mass-based separation, and/or target capture.
14 . The method of claim 13 , wherein the sample comprises one or more of a plasma sample, a whole blood sample, a leukocyte sample, a serum sample, and/or a tissue sample.
15 . The method of claim 13 , further comprising measuring a level of cancer antigen 125 (CA-125) in the sample.
16 . The method of claim 13 , wherein the reagent that modifies DNA in a methylation-specific manner is a bisulfite reagent.
